Is Lincoln Owned by Ford?

1 Answers
MacMarley
07/30/25 4:47am
Lincoln is a luxury car brand under Ford, founded by Henry Leland. The Lincoln brand's product lineup primarily includes: MKC, MKZ, Continental, Mark VIII, Town Car, and Navigator, among others. In China, the Lincoln sedans commonly used are mostly from the Town Car series. Taking the Lincoln Navigator as an example: it is a large SUV launched by Lincoln, with dimensions of 5355mm in length, 2073mm in width, and 1937mm in height, and a wheelbase of 3112mm. It is equipped with a 3.5L V6 twin-turbocharged engine, delivering a maximum power of 285kW, and is paired with a 10-speed automatic transmission.

Why is the right garage narrow?

Right garage being narrow is due to turning the steering wheel too early during reverse parking. Reverse parking method: Taking right reverse parking as an example, the distance between the car at the starting position and the left line should be 1.2-1.8 meters, the steering wheel should be straight, and the car body should be parallel to the left line. When reversing, use the lower edge of the left rearview mirror as a reference. When the two coincide, turn the steering wheel fully to the right and continue reversing. Deduction criteria: Main points for deduction in reverse parking include driving over the line, the car not entering the garage, exceeding the time limit, and not following the designated route. Reverse parking must be completed within 210 seconds; exceeding the time limit results in disqualification. Not following the sequence also leads to disqualification. During reverse parking, pay attention to observing the 30cm side margin issue.

Should the wiper be turned on during rainy days for Subject 2 driving test?

It is not mandatory to turn on the wiper during the Subject 2 driving test in rainy weather. However, if the rain affects driving visibility, it is advisable to use the wiper. Here is some relevant information: Wiper: The wiper is an important accessory installed on the windshield, designed to clear rain, snow, and dust that obstruct the view on the windshield. Therefore, it plays a crucial role in driving safety. The wiper switch for most vehicle models is located on the right-hand stalk behind the steering wheel, typically in the form of a stalk. Subject 2: Subject 2, also known as the small road test, is part of the motor vehicle driver's license examination, specifically referring to the field driving skills test. For the C1 license, the test items include five mandatory components: reversing into a parking space, parallel parking, stopping and starting on a slope, right-angle turns, and curve driving (commonly known as S-turns). Some regions may include a sixth item: highway toll card collection. For the C2 license, the test items include four mandatory components: reversing into a parking space, parallel parking, right-angle turns, and curve driving (commonly known as S-turns).

Why is the right side narrow when reversing into the right parking space?

Right side being narrow when reversing into the parking space is due to turning the steering wheel too early or driving too fast when entering. When reversing, always pay attention to both rearview mirrors. If you notice the rear corner is slightly narrow, immediately straighten the steering wheel or make slight reverse adjustments. In summary, driving too slowly, too quickly, or turning the steering wheel too fast or slow can all affect whether the right or left side becomes narrow. Maintaining a normal speed and finding the right timing to turn the steering wheel can correct this issue. Tips for reversing into a parking space: Before turning the steering wheel, keep the inner side of the car as close as possible to the obstacle to leave more turning space for the outer side. Also, be mindful of the front corner of the outer obstacle and the rear obstacle to avoid collisions. Maintain a distance of about 1.5 meters from the adjacent car, start reversing, turn the steering wheel fully as needed, and straighten it once the car is in the space. Continue reversing until the parking is complete.

Why is the pressure in the Vito's fuel low-pressure circuit too low?

Low pressure in the Vito's fuel low-pressure circuit can be caused by damaged injectors, incorrect pressure sensor signals, and other reasons. Specific causes of low pressure: Internal blockage in the high-pressure fuel pump or abnormal operation of the pressure regulator. The cold start solenoid valve is stuck in the normally open position. Damaged injectors, leading to excessive fuel return or large amounts of fuel leaking into the cylinders. Bends, collapses, or blockages in the low-pressure fuel line causing poor fuel supply. Incorrect pressure sensor signals. Damaged electric fuel pump. Meaning of the low-pressure circuit: The so-called low-pressure fuel circuit refers to the fuel line from the fuel tank to the high-pressure fuel pump; in other words, the fuel line through which the fuel passes before being pressurized by the pump is called the low-pressure fuel circuit. The low-pressure circuit refers to the fuel line returning from the fuel metering valve.
